2023-09-15 10:37:41 UTC
781 MB
docker:local
ENABLE_TOOLJET_DBtrue
HOME/home/appuser
LD_LIBRARY_PATH/opt/oracle/instantclient_11_2:/opt/oracle/instantclient_21_10:
LOCKBOX_MASTER_KEYreplace_with_lockbox_master_key
NODE_ENVproduction
NODE_OPTIONS--max-old-space-size=4096
ORM_LOGGINGtrue
PATH/usr/local/lib/nodejs/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
PGRST_DB_URIpostgres://tooljet:postgres@localhost/tooljet_db
PGRST_HOSThttp://localhost:3000
PGRST_JWT_SECRETr9iMKoe5CRMgvJBBtp4HrqN7QiPpUToj
PG_DBtooljet_production
PG_HOSTlocalhost
PG_PASSpostgres
PG_USERtooljet
PORT80
SECRET_KEY_BASEreplace_with_secret_key_base
TERMxterm
TOOLJET_DBtooljet_db
TOOLJET_DB_HOSTlocalhost
TOOLJET_DB_PASSpostgres
TOOLJET_DB_USERtooljet
TOOLJET_HOSThttp://localhost
npm_config_cache/home/appuser/.npm
[#000] sha256:5dea071bb9782209397443f024a630052ab7583e365894d414f1e39cd0f65025 - 6.72% (52.5 MB)
[#001] sha256:e52534bee530cf1309d7ec87a9c195723222e18885e3486e7176894e3a791ed1 - 16.85% (132 MB)
[#002] sha256:59ef021e79da62839920bab4c13be48700e3ed5a65858d0c790653042cd385df - 5.52% (43.1 MB)
[#003] sha256:09bda3f70f95d4c58246f935ab31e48504250ba78b484526dbe0ad8bb7da530e - 0.72% (5.62 MB)
[#004] sha256:d931a09528e8e8cf893f827c50a9fe58dbd873a1708ac459b5f0069fe953fe0d - 0.0% (115 Bytes)
[#005] sha256:f8527790da3eaa206c4ff27ac2b6547732b7e2321cd613335ffc182e6fff19bb - 6.14% (47.9 MB)
[#006] sha256:41e3d849c134f11c99f9c97d4afdad2591386d0882abf0985069db2116e06b7c - 0.0% (92 Bytes)
[#007] sha256:4a444c86dfc58c4a61c798960602eb18eebe642f111fa20c5f6b2d28636dc3ff - 0.0% (781 Bytes)
[#008] sha256:9bdcd208a86f8a6150a510ba19aed8d5319247e9bef2899c80edbe75dd7d1a3f - 0.03% (248 KB)
[#009] sha256:ae80080fbd72d326b4a99df8fc68d0e8ef908b4cacea03694f255d82366d1765 - 0.0% (2.04 KB)
[#010] sha256:62526671b88062aa9856ed43d52f04a582d172284acca215850522064b930d0d - 14.6% (114 MB)
[#011] sha256:d9b495fb702e0cb8686c9772655b259cdaff525584a232d8048168e0b5bdb041 - 0.0% (28.8 KB)
[#012] sha256:46b5d1dca59adc0a4840e3f8faf1df6e8125e0dae12b77499a90881583d54820 - 0.0% (1.04 KB)
[#013] sha256:44d5541cfca2a6a1fe491b5eb087bd28430794f49f09141a2918868494e3b44f - 2.65% (20.7 MB)
[#014] sha256:15ac255c66edc4fb847f278e74d4f4333d36a2470f2f0d98b0a30a37a0d3988a - 0.0% (1.55 KB)
[#015] sha256:a75b3f85bbe8085a73551a5ccc56f9b755623cda3ac2950669c6573eb69b9c3d - 0.0% (163 Bytes)
[#016] sha256:d406510f4be935d492c2f473dc78519ad58f39b85e97d736d923797bfdc6b1da - 0.0% (479 Bytes)
[#017] sha256:930c7a5f8d9267e9c26432214a8899950f8eeb671558f4a09bd17e188e17f43a - 5.97% (46.7 MB)
[#018] sha256:6fa59f11334bf93d7506ec0dd574353f6ce92dc0c845198128d6463fd6e0a469 - 0.11% (883 KB)
[#019] sha256:a9062f56d2f82452f956dc1c85dac80345af4ca69913cdf50fa992baf1566869 - 0.0% (4.72 KB)
[#020] sha256:f4333575d573ce8f0b39d147fb70438ead79af48735f87c750c4eea5a2c78702 - 0.05% (418 KB)
[#021] sha256:3bed921e8ad81d96692055beaad4ef305b2abd29a7b03d0b5da474f855350d2c - 23.9% (187 MB)
[#022] sha256:4f4fb700ef54461cfa02571ae0db9a0dc1e0cdb5577484a6d75e68dc38e8acc1 - 0.0% (32 Bytes)
[#023] sha256:3886db62c6cb44c17187cfd361b119e7245e9b982f9c718259f004a2d54da8d5 - 0.96% (7.5 MB)
[#024] sha256:37eae06afa40402d70816777b8e0490f988c21d5fbc94c89e0a947d3ef77a78f - 0.61% (4.74 MB)
[#025] sha256:00c59532a95de99c6a1c9fb1f4d4eea86352ec3c26a72e2b53d3cfbfd027cbfc - 0.0% (3.77 KB)
[#026] sha256:e52d6b315f32113ce47957389986b1f5ee18aabe8cb4d3831b67473290047f5d - 0.0% (222 Bytes)
[#027] sha256:4f4fb700ef54461cfa02571ae0db9a0dc1e0cdb5577484a6d75e68dc38e8acc1 - 0.0% (32 Bytes)
[#028] sha256:d102230a93fde7d650bdb4e8e33e1f28835ec5e359cd3848e1fb0f87a1f3a5da - 14.99% (117 MB)
[#029] sha256:ea9db64df26f75ea07437d52b47d956d055fcd3ee27cb153c331ecfcdd93c510 - 0.19% (1.49 MB)
[#030] sha256:a48c50dfe62f53af386bf57bd79a565659bd7be0d2ce80edc496430b652e8686 - 0.0% (330 Bytes)
/bin/sh -c #(nop) ADD file:144dff349a666134b5e98a9f1c6650fd9d6e4a88a6f98857f26eb84989360b91 in /
2023-09-07 00:21:02 UTC/bin/sh -c #(nop) CMD ["bash"]
2023-09-15 10:26:17 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c apt-get update -yq && apt-get install curl gnupg zip -yq && apt-get install -yq build-essential && apt-get clean -y # buildkit
2023-09-15 10:26:22 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c curl -O https://nodejs.org/dist/v18.3.0/node-v18.3.0-linux-x64.tar.xz && tar -xf node-v18.3.0-linux-x64.tar.xz && mv node-v18.3.0-linux-x64 /usr/local/lib/nodejs && echo 'export PATH="/usr/local/lib/nodejs/bin:$PATH"' >> /etc/profile.d/nodejs.sh && /bin/bash -c "source /etc/profile.d/nodejs.sh" && rm node-v18.3.0-linux-x64.tar.xz # buildkit
2023-09-15 10:26:29 UTC (buildkit.dockerfile.v0)ENV PATH=/usr/local/lib/nodejs/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
2023-09-15 10:26:29 UTC (buildkit.dockerfile.v0)ENV NODE_ENV=production
2023-09-15 10:26:29 UTC (buildkit.dockerfile.v0)ENV NODE_OPTIONS=--max-old-space-size=4096
2023-09-15 10:26:29 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c apt-get update && apt-get install -y postgresql-client freetds-dev libaio1 wget && apt-get -o Dpkg::Options::="--force-confold" upgrade -q -y --force-yes && apt-get -y autoremove && apt-get -y autoclean # buildkit
2023-09-15 10:26:29 UTC (buildkit.dockerfile.v0)WORKDIR /opt/oracle
2023-09-15 10:26:35 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c wget https://tooljet-plugins-production.s3.us-east-2.amazonaws.com/marketplace-assets/oracledb/instantclients/instantclient-basiclite-linuxx64.zip && wget https://tooljet-plugins-production.s3.us-east-2.amazonaws.com/marketplace-assets/oracledb/instantclients/instantclient-basiclite-linux.x64-11.2.0.4.0.zip && unzip instantclient-basiclite-linuxx64.zip && rm -f instantclient-basiclite-linuxx64.zip && unzip instantclient-basiclite-linux.x64-11.2.0.4.0.zip && rm -f instantclient-basiclite-linux.x64-11.2.0.4.0.zip && cd /opt/oracle/instantclient_21_10 && rm -f *jdbc* *occi* *mysql* *mql1* *ipc1* *jar uidrvci genezi adrci && cd /opt/oracle/instantclient_11_2 && rm -f *jdbc* *occi* *mysql* *mql1* *ipc1* *jar uidrvci genezi adrci && echo /opt/oracle/instantclient* > /etc/ld.so.conf.d/oracle-instantclient.conf && ldconfig # buildkit
2023-09-15 10:26:35 UTC (buildkit.dockerfile.v0)ENV LD_LIBRARY_PATH=/opt/oracle/instantclient_11_2:/opt/oracle/instantclient_21_10:
2023-09-15 10:26:35 UTC (buildkit.dockerfile.v0)WORKDIR /
2023-09-15 10:26:35 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c mkdir -p /app # buildkit
2023-09-15 10:33:09 UTC (buildkit.dockerfile.v0)COPY /app/package.json ./app/package.json # buildkit
2023-09-15 10:33:09 UTC (buildkit.dockerfile.v0)COPY /app/plugins/dist ./app/plugins/dist # buildkit
2023-09-15 10:33:11 UTC (buildkit.dockerfile.v0)COPY /app/plugins/client.js ./app/plugins/client.js #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/plugins/node_modules ./app/plugins/node_modules #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/plugins/packages/common ./app/plugins/packages/common #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/plugins/package.json ./app/plugins/package.json #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/frontend/build ./app/frontend/build #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/server/package.json ./app/server/package.json #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/server/.version ./app/server/.version # buildkit
2023-09-15 10:33:17 UTC (buildkit.dockerfile.v0)COPY /app/server/entrypoint.sh ./app/server/entrypoint.sh # buildkit
2023-09-15 10:33:22 UTC (buildkit.dockerfile.v0)COPY /app/server/node_modules ./app/server/node_modules # buildkit
2023-09-15 10:33:22 UTC (buildkit.dockerfile.v0)COPY /app/server/templates ./app/server/templates # buildkit
2023-09-15 10:33:22 UTC (buildkit.dockerfile.v0)COPY /app/server/scripts ./app/server/scripts # buildkit
2023-09-15 10:33:22 UTC (buildkit.dockerfile.v0)COPY /app/server/dist ./app/server/dist # buildkit
2023-09-15 10:34:12 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c useradd --create-home --home-dir /home/appuser appuser && chown -R appuser:0 /app && chown -R appuser:0 /home/appuser && chmod u+x /app && chmod -R g=u /app # buildkit
2023-09-15 10:34:12 UTC (buildkit.dockerfile.v0)ENV npm_config_cache=/home/appuser/.npm
2023-09-15 10:34:12 UTC (buildkit.dockerfile.v0)ENV HOME=/home/appuser
2023-09-15 10:34:12 UTC (buildkit.dockerfile.v0)USER appuser
2023-09-15 10:34:12 UTC (buildkit.dockerfile.v0)WORKDIR /app
2023-09-15 10:34:18 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c npm install dotenv@10.0.0 joi@17.4.1 # buildkit
2023-09-15 10:34:18 UTC (buildkit.dockerfile.v0)ENTRYPOINT ["./server/entrypoint.sh"]
2023-09-15 10:37:14 UTC (buildkit.dockerfile.v0)COPY /bin/postgrest /bin # buildkit
2023-09-15 10:37:15 UTC (buildkit.dockerfile.v0)USER root
2023-09-15 10:37:15 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c wget --quiet -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| apt-key add - # buildkit
2023-09-15 10:37:15 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c echo "deb http://apt.postgresql.org/pub/repos/apt/ bullseye-pgdg main" | tee /etc/apt/sources.list.d/pgdg.list # buildkit
2023-09-15 10:37:15 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c echo "deb http://deb.debian.org/debian" # buildkit
2023-09-15 10:37:38 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c apt update && apt -y install postgresql-13 postgresql-client-13 supervisor # buildkit
2023-09-15 10:37:38 UTC (buildkit.dockerfile.v0)USER postgres
2023-09-15 10:37:41 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c service postgresql start && psql -c "create role tooljet with login superuser password 'postgres';" # buildkit
2023-09-15 10:37:41 UTC (buildkit.dockerfile.v0)USER root
2023-09-15 10:37:41 UTC (buildkit.dockerfile.v0)RUN /bin/sh -c echo "[supervisord] \n" "nodaemon=true \n" "\n" "[program:postgrest] \n" "command=/bin/postgrest \n" "autostart=true \n" "autorestart=true \n" "\n" "[program:tooljet] \n" "command=/bin/bash -c '/app/server/scripts/init-db-boot.sh' \n" "autostart=true \n" "autorestart=true \n" "stderr_logfile=/dev/stdout \n" "stderr_logfile_maxbytes=0 \n" "stdout_logfile=/dev/stdout \n" "stdout_logfile_maxbytes=0 \n" | sed 's/ //' > /etc/supervisor/conf.d/supervisord.conf # buildkit
2023-09-15 10:37:41 UTC (buildkit.dockerfile.v0)ENV TOOLJET_HOST=http://localhost PORT=80 NODE_ENV=production LOCKBOX_MASTER_KEY=replace_with_lockbox_master_key SECRET_KEY_BASE=replace_with_secret_key_base PG_DB=tooljet_production PG_USER=tooljet PG_PASS=postgres PG_HOST=localhost ENABLE_TOOLJET_DB=true TOOLJET_DB_HOST=localhost TOOLJET_DB_USER=tooljet TOOLJET_DB_PASS=postgres TOOLJET_DB=tooljet_db PGRST_HOST=http://localhost:3000 PGRST_DB_URI=postgres://tooljet:postgres@localhost/tooljet_db PGRST_JWT_SECRET=r9iMKoe5CRMgvJBBtp4HrqN7QiPpUToj ORM_LOGGING=true DEPLOYMENT_PLATFORM=docker:local HOME=/home/appuser TERM=xterm
2023-09-15 10:37:41 UTC (buildkit.dockerfile.v0)ENTRYPOINT ["/bin/sh" "-c" "service postgresql start 1> /dev/null && /usr/bin/supervisord"]
Please be careful as this will not just delete the reference but also the actual content!
For example when you have latest and v1.2.3 both pointing to the same image
the deletion of latest will also permanently remove v1.2.3.